DNA Diagnostics Center is the world leader in DNA relationship testing, processing over one million DNA samples from customers all over the world. Our broad portfolio of products includes our Paternity, Immigration, and other DNA Relationship services for consumers, government agencies, healthcare providers, and legal professionals; PeekabooTM Early Gender DNA Test for expecting mothers; SpermCheck fertility and vasectomy test; and Pets & Vets DNA testing for breeders and pet enthusiasts. Our corporate headquarters, including our DNA testing laboratory, is based in Fairfield, OH in the greater Cincinnati Area. DDC is part of Eurofins, a global scientific company with over 800 laboratories in 50 countries and more than 50,000 employees.

In over just 30 years, Eurofins has grown from one laboratory in Nantes, France to 55,000 staff across a decentralised and entrepreneurial network of 900 laboratories in over 50 countries. Eurofins offers a portfolio of over 200,000 analytical methods to evaluate the safety, identity, composition, authenticity, origin, traceability and purity of biological substances and products.

Job Description

*2nd Shift Position (M-F 12:30pm-9:00pm)*

Laboratory Technologists play a key role in executing basic laboratory procedures with accuracy, precision, and efficiency. This individual ensures compliance with standardized protocols while maintaining quality control in a fast-paced environment. The ideal candidate thrives in a detail-oriented setting, follows procedures meticulously, and contributes to the integrity of DNA analysis. As part of a collaborative team, Laboratory Technologists are responsible for processing samples within the paternity lab while adhering to safety and regulatory guidelines to support DDC’s mission of providing reliable DNA testing services.

  • Determine the acceptability of specimens for testing according to established criteria
  • Perform routine and complex technical procedures and functions according to SOPs
  • Process biological samples, including extraction, quantification, amplification, and analysis of DNA.
  • Operate laboratory instruments and equipment.
  • Demonstrate the ability to make technical decisions regarding testing and problem solving.
  • Maintain a safe work environment and wear appropriate personal protective equipment
  • Collaborate effectively with laboratory staff, supervisors, and management to optimize workflows.
  • Ensure and maintain compliance with the Company’s quality system requirements through training and adherence to policies, procedures and processes
  • Maintain confidentiality of sensitive information and data.
  • Other duties as assigned or become evident
